Output 405863dd079d9185a66a765780a29aa0a5edf4fa337519663e3637262c9cb752:6

value
113525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b01b9e4940988dddc9d353e74d16bb37fee41c2 OP_EQUAL
address
3EN1v9EYpbRDFxGka8zBnwUpREUVT26Zwu
transaction
405863dd079d9185a66a765780a29aa0a5edf4fa337519663e3637262c9cb752
confirmations
180912
spent
true